Basic Information

Product Name Thiophosphoric Acid o-[2-Chloro-1-(2,4-Dibromophenyl)Ethenyl]O,o-Dimethyl Ester
CAS No. 1217-96-5
Molecular Formula C10H10Br2ClO3PS
Molecular Weight 428.48 g/mol
Synonyms O-[2-Chloro-1-(2,4-dibromophenyl)ethenyl] O,O-dimethyl phosphorothioate; Phosphorothioic acid, O-[2-chloro-1-(2,4-dibromophenyl)ethenyl] O,O-dimethyl ester; 2-Chloro-1-(2,4-dibromophenyl)vinyl dimethyl phosphorothioate; Dimethyl O-[2-chloro-1-(2,4-dibromophenyl)vinyl] phosphorothioate; NSC 190986

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at controlled room temperature (15-25°C/59-77°F). This compound is easily oxidized; for long-term storage, consider maintaining under an inert atmosphere such as nitrogen or argon. Keep away from strong bases and incompatible materials.
